Technical Field
The utility model relates to a panel processing equipment technical field, concretely relates to panel scraping device.
Background
The board section of wooden furniture is equipped with the banding area more to carry out solid sealing to the section of panel, avoid moisture etc. to the destruction of panel, also can prevent that the inside formaldehyde of panel from volatilizing, reach the pleasing to the eye effect of decoration simultaneously. At present, the sealing is generally carried out by adopting an edge sealing machine, and then the trimming is carried out by a trimming machine. Like in the patent document of patent No. 202010643447.6, disclosed a panel and scraped limit device, but often because of the height or the thickness difference of panel, and cause the problem that can't scrape limit work, the utility model discloses an improvement made on its basis.

A plate edge scraping device comprises at least one processing unit, wherein the processing unit comprises an edge scraping blade 11, a base 12 and a power device 13, specifically, the power device is an air cylinder, and can also be a hydraulic cylinder, an electric telescopic rod and other linear driving devices, the power device drives the edge scraping blade to move up and down on the base 12, a spring is arranged between the blade and the base, the edge scraping blade moves towards a processed plate direction through the spring and has a moving fastening force between the blade and the base, so that an edge scraping function is realized, the base 12 is arranged on a table top 2 and can slide up and down on the table top 2, a height adjusting device 3 is arranged between the base 12 and the table top 2 to adjust the height of the base 12, specifically, two optical axes 31 which are vertically arranged are arranged on the table top, a through hole matched with the optical axes is arranged on the base 12, thereby realize the upper and lower slip of base 12, height adjusting device include first lead screw 32 and first nut 33, first lead screw 32 rotate and set up the upper end at optical axis 31, first nut 33 and base 12 fixed connection, first lead screw and first nut 33 screw-thread fit, can adjust the height of first nut and base 12 through rotating first lead screw, just first lead screw 32 on be provided with the digit ware, the height value of adjustment can be directly perceived to observe, can come adjusting device's height according to the height of the machined surface of panel to the adaptability of equipment has been improved.
Specifically, base 12 slide along the fore-and-aft direction and set up on mesa 2, base 12 and mesa 2 between be provided with the fore-and-aft position that adjusting device 4 adjusted base 12, specifically, the fixed setting on slider 41 of lower extreme of optical axis 31, mesa 2 on be provided with slider 41 complex along the slide rail 42 that the fore-and-aft direction set up, slider 42 on rotate and be connected with second lead screw 43, mesa 2 on fixedly be provided with second nut 44, second lead screw 43 and second nut 44 screw-thread fit, can adjust the fore-and-aft position of slider 41 through twisting second lead screw 43, just the slider on be provided with scale 46, the mesa on fixed header 45 that is provided with, header 45 and scale cooperation can observe the fore-and-aft position of slider directly perceivedly, be convenient for adjust. In another embodiment, the height adjusting device and the front and rear adjusting device can be realized by using a linear driving mechanism such as an air cylinder, a hydraulic cylinder, an electric telescopic rod, etc., and can be adjusted according to the front and rear positions of the machined surface of the plate, and if the side surface of the machined plate is a bent surface or an inclined surface, the position of the plate in front of the plate needs to be subjected to edge scraping treatment, so that the adaptability of the equipment is improved.
Specifically, base 12 on install inductive probe 5, inductive probe 5 respond to whether the processing position of scraping limit blade 11 has a panel, specifically, inductive probe 5 fixed set up on base 12, inductive probe 5 be proximity switch. Whether plates enter the scraping edge working position or not can be automatically identified through the inductive probe, so that starting and stopping of the scraper device are automatically controlled, and the automation degree is improved.
Specifically, the two processing units are symmetrically arranged one above the other, so that the upper surface and the lower surface of the plate can be processed simultaneously.
In a second embodiment, a polishing device 6 is fixedly disposed on the base 12, the polishing device 6 includes a polishing motor 61 and a polishing wheel 62, the polishing motor 61 is fixedly disposed on the base 12, and the polishing wheel 62 is driven by the polishing motor 61 to rotate. The edge scraping and polishing device can polish the plate while scraping the edge, and integrates the edge scraping and the polishing in one operation step, thereby saving the operation time and simplifying the operation action.
Specifically, the baffle 63 is arranged above the polishing wheel 62, and the baffle 63 is fixedly arranged on the polishing motor, so that danger caused by mistaken touch of an operator on the polishing wheel is avoided, and the safety is improved.
The specific working process is as follows: according to the thickness of the panel of processing, the front and back position of machined surface height and machined position, adjust the height and the front and back position of this device, place panel two from top to bottom scrape between the limit blade, inductive probe senses behind the panel, scrape the limit blade and remove to panel through power device 13 drive, scrape the limit blade under the effect of spring and self gravity, it has tight resultant force to scrape between limit blade and the panel, constantly remove panel, the impurity on the upper and lower two sides of panel is struck off totally, panel enters into between two upper and lower polishing wheels after scraping the limit blade, the rethread polishing wheel polishes.
